For the Petitioner/s : Mr. Sanjay Kumar Singh, Adv. For the Opposite Party/s : Mr. Aditya Narayan Singh 1, APP ====================================================== CORAM: HONOURABLE MR. JUSTICE S. KUMAR ORAL ORDER 19-09-2018 Heard learned counsel for petitioner and learned A.P.P. for the State.
The petitioner seeks bail in Sonpur P.S. Case No. 63/2017, registered for the offences punishable under Sections 302 and 34 of the Indian Penal Code.
Earlier, prayer for regular bail of petitioner was rejected by this court vide order dated 13.12.2017 passed in Cr. Misc. 49899/2017.
Allegation against the petitioner and others is that they borrowed huge money from brother of the informant. When brother of informant demanded his money, petitioner paid Rs. 17,000/- and assured to return the rest amount. Thereafter petitioner and co-accused, took away brother of the informant and killed him.
It has been submitted that petitioner has falsely been
Patna High Court Cr.Misc. No.57977 of 2018 (2) dt.19-09-2018 2/3 implicated in this case. His name surfaced in the case on the basis of suspicion. There is no eye-witness of the occurrence. Petitioner has no criminal antecedent. He is in custody since 31.05.2017. Co-accused Ramesh Rai has been granted anticipatory bail by this Hon'ble Court as contained in Annex-3 Considering the facts aforesaid, the petitioner abovenamed, is directed to be enlarged on bail on furnishing bail bond of Rs. 10,000/- (Ten thousand) with two sureties of the like amount each to the satisfaction of Additional District & Sessions Judge X, Saran at Chapra in connection with Sonpur P.S. Case No. 63/2017, subject to the conditions:
(1.) Bailors should be local having sufficient immovable property within the jurisdiction of the court concerned.
(2.) Petitioner shall co-operate in the trial and shall be present on each and every date fixed by the court and his absence on two consecutive dates without proper and reasonable reason will be sufficient to cancel his bail bonds.
(3.) If the petitioner tampers with the evidence or the witnesses of the case, in that case,
